The US special envoys to the Middle East William Burns and retired general Anthony Zinni discussed on Saturday with the Egyptian president Hosni Mubarak the deteriorating situations in the occupied territories.
The meeting which was attended by the Egyptian foreign minister Ahmad Maher and the US ambassador in Cairo David Walsh came in light of the efforts exerted to contain the grave situations in the occupied Palestinian lands as a result of the escalating Israeli military aggressions on the Palestinian people. The meeting also came within the frameworks of the intensive contacts made by Egypt to contain the worsening conditions between the Israelis and Palestinians and to persuade them return to the negotiating table in order to avert the region a state of unrest and chaos—Albawaba.com
